Records per Page:
Click on column headers to sort up/down.
Business NameCityBusiness TypeStatusRatingDistanceRow
Colony Concrete Company Williamsburg Concrete Contractors 6925
Baltazar & Son Grottoes Concrete Contractors 6926
A. Morris Construction Inc Williamsburg Concrete Contractors 6927
Seven Hills Asphalt Solutions Lynchburg Concrete Contractors 7028
L & A Concrete Construction Services LLC Lynchburg Concrete Contractors 7029
Vanquish Home Services Bealeton Concrete Contractors 7130
Littleton Foundation Repair Littleton Concrete Contractors 7631
Perfect Parking Asphalt Services Harrisonburg Concrete Contractors 8032
Medhus Construction Inc Gloucester Point Concrete Contractors 8133
JP Concrete Woodbridge Concrete Contractors 8334
Business & Construction Investments Woodbridge Concrete Contractors 8335
Newport News Concrete Company Newport News Concrete Contractors 8436
David Barco Plasterings LLC Newport News Concrete Contractors 8437
Cortes Over the Top LLC - Newport News Newport News Concrete Contractors 8438
Mountain View Concrete La Plata Concrete Contractors 8539
DT Building LLC Carrollton Concrete Contractors 8540
Ceramica Universal Llc La Plata Concrete Contractors 8541
Ebenezer Roofing LLC Manassas Concrete Contractors 8642
Ebenezer general contractor innovation Manassas Concrete Contractors 8643
DL Adams Contracting, LLC Great Mills Concrete Contractors 9244
MD Custom Construction Hollywood Concrete Contractors 9245
Newkirk Services, Inc. Centreville Concrete Contractors 9346
Metro Sealant & Waterproofing Supply, Inc. Springfield Concrete Contractors 9447
Wilson Construction LLC Springfield Concrete Contractors 9448
Concrete Guys Hampton Hampton Concrete Contractors 9649
 
© Copyright 2017 TrustLink All Rights Reserved.